Public Policy Overview
- Implementation and enforcement of policies are carried out by government agencies and police forces.
- The media plays a crucial role in shaping public policy by providing essential information about policies.
Steps in Policy Creation
- The initial phase of public policy creation is identifying a problem that requires intervention.
- Officials primarily recognize policy issues by paying attention to public interest groups.
Roles and Relationships
- Diplomats and ambassadors are responsible for fostering strong relations with other nations to safeguard national security.
- Government leaders determine which issues to tackle through fiscal policy.
Influences on Public Policy
- Special interest groups are likely to organize fundraising campaigns to support candidates aligned with their interests, such as pro-gun senators.
- The media influences public policy by highlighting failures or pressing needs for certain policies.
Legislative Role
- The main responsibility of the legislature in the public policy process is to pass laws that address identified issues.
Focus Areas of Public Policy
- Public policies generally seek to address challenges within three primary domains: social, economic, and foreign affairs.
